Output adcfaaca94c5bf96539cfeed713a1733d5ac41f7ffbc9473c680a551b0d130a8:0

value
2890665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2580a78c73891e69479fdaf4127a39e638e01c82 OP_EQUAL
address
357K3iFDZ8hRcDvGLhwdtj5QdeBCuE2dQP
transaction
adcfaaca94c5bf96539cfeed713a1733d5ac41f7ffbc9473c680a551b0d130a8
spent
true